Description
General Editors: David Grinlinton, the Honourable Peter Salmon CNZM KC
Authors: Dr Klaus Bosselmann, Matthew Casey KC, Trevor Daya-Winterbottom, Karenza de Silva, Grant Hewison, Bjørn-Oliver Magsig, Vernon Rive, Ceri Warnock, Nicola Wheen
Since it was published in 2015, Environmental Law in New Zealand has gained a reputation as a ground-breaking, innovative commentary on the wide range of topics that encompass the field of environmental law.
The third edition continues under the leadership of General Editors Peter Salmon KC and Professor David Grinlinton, who lead a team of expert authors to produce a work of outstanding scholarship and practical value. The text brings together analysis of the conceptual underpinning and theoretical influences guiding the evolution of environmental law, along with the practical applications and challenges.
This new edition incorporates discussion of:
- Significant law reform and regulatory changes such as the use of “fast-track” processes for developments of national priority.
- Integration of Tikanga Māori and its importance in Environmental Law.
- Climate Change litigation domestically and internationally.
- International Law and Agreements including Human Rights and International Trade.
- Sustainability and Ecological Integrity.
- Statutory frameworks for land, water, coastal, atmospheric, ecological, and heritage management, as well as compliance and enforcement systems.
- Ongoing reforms to the Resource Management Act and questions the consistency of proposed changes with the Act’s foundational principles.
Environmental Law in New Zealand (3rd edition) continues to serve as an authoritative reference for lawyers, the judiciary, law students and members of the general public who wish to gain insights into and an understanding of the rich tapestry that is environmental law in New Zealand.
Environmental Law in New Zealand, now in its third edition, is firmly established as the indispensable text for anyone who wants to understand New Zealand environmental law and the principles and goals that will shape its direction in the future.
